\name{geom_text}
\alias{geom_text}
\title{Textual annotations.}
\usage{
geom_text(mapping = NULL, data = NULL, stat = "identity",
position = "identity", parse = FALSE, ..., nudge_x = 0, nudge_y = 0,
check_overlap = FALSE, show_guide = NA)
}
\arguments{
\item{mapping}{The aesthetic mapping, usually constructed with
\code{\link{aes}} or \code{\link{aes_string}}. Only needs to be set
at the layer level if you are overriding the plot defaults.}
\item{data}{A data frame. If specified, overrides the default data frame
defined at the top level of the plot.}
\item{stat}{The statistical transformation to use on the data for this
layer, as a string.}
\item{position}{Postion adjustment, either as a string, or the result of
a call to a position adjustment function.}
\item{parse}{If TRUE, the labels will be parsed into expressions and
displayed as described in ?plotmath}
\item{...}{other arguments passed on to \code{\link{layer}}. There are
three types of arguments you can use here:
\itemize{
\item Aesthetics: to set an aesthetic to a fixed value, like
\code{color = "red"} or \code{size = 3}.
\item Other arguments to the layer, for example you override the
default \code{stat} associated with the layer.
\item Other arguments passed on to the stat.
}}
\item{nudge_x,nudge_y}{Horizontal and vertical adjustment to nudge labels by.
Useful for offseting text from points, particularly on discrete scales.}
\item{check_overlap}{If \code{TRUE}, text that overlaps previous text in the
same layer will not be plotted. A quick and dirty way}
\item{show_guide}{logical. Should this layer be included in the legends?
\code{NA}, the default, includes if any aesthetics are mapped.
\code{FALSE} never includes, and \code{TRUE} always includes.}
}
\description{
Textual annotations.
}
\section{Aesthetics}{
\Sexpr[results=rd,stage=build]{ggplot2:::rd_aesthetics("geom", "text")}
}
\section{Alignment}{
You can modify text alignment with the \code{vjust} and \code{hjust}
aesthetics. These can either be a number between 0 (right/bottom) and
1 (top/left) or a character ("left", "middle", "right", "bottom", "center",
"top"). There are two special alignments: "inward" and "outward".
Inward always aligns text towards the center, and outward aligns
it away from the center
}
\examples{
p <- ggplot(mtcars, aes(wt, mpg, label = rownames(mtcars)))
p + geom_text()
# Avoid overlaps
p + geom_text(check_overlap = TRUE)
# Change size of the label
p + geom_text(size = 10)
# Set aesthetics to fixed value
p + geom_point() + geom_text(hjust = 0, nudge_x = 0.05)
p + geom_point() + geom_text(vjust = 0, nudge_y = 0.5)
p + geom_point() + geom_text(angle = 45)
\dontrun{
p + geom_text(family = "Times New Roman")
}
# Add aesthetic mappings
p + geom_text(aes(colour = factor(cyl)))
p + geom_text(aes(colour = factor(cyl))) +
scale_colour_discrete(l = 40)
p + geom_text(aes(size = wt))
# Scale height of text, rather than sqrt(height)
p + geom_text(aes(size = wt)) + scale_radius(range = c(3,6))
# You can display expressions by setting parse = TRUE. The
# details of the display are described in ?plotmath, but note that
# geom_text uses strings, not expressions.
p + geom_text(aes(label = paste(wt, "^(", cyl, ")", sep = "")),
parse = TRUE)
# Add a text annotation
p +
geom_text() +
annotate("text", label = "plot mpg vs. wt", x = 2, y = 15, size = 8, colour = "red")
# Justification -------------------------------------------------------------
df <- data.frame(
x = c(1, 1, 2, 2, 1.5),
y = c(1, 2, 1, 2, 1.5),
text = c("bottom-left", "bottom-right", "top-left", "top-right", "center")
)
ggplot(df, aes(x, y)) +
geom_text(aes(label = text))
ggplot(df, aes(x, y)) +
geom_text(aes(label = text), vjust = "inward", hjust = "inward")
}
